Chimney inspection services involve a thorough evaluation of a chimney’s interior and exterior components to identify potential issues. Trained professionals utilize specialized tools such as cameras and flashlights to examine the flue liner, damper, chimney crown, and masonry for signs of damage, deterioration, or obstructions. This process helps ensure that the chimney functions properly and is safe for use. Regular inspections can detect problems early, preventing more significant issues that could lead to costly repairs or fire hazards.

These services are essential for addressing common chimney problems like creosote buildup, cracks, blockages, and structural damage. Creosote, a byproduct of burning wood, can accumulate over time and increase the risk of chimney fires if not properly cleaned. Cracks and deterioration in the chimney structure can allow water intrusion, leading to further damage and weakening the overall system. Inspections help identify these issues before they escalate, enabling timely maintenance and repairs that maintain the safety and efficiency of the chimney.

What is included in a chimney inspection service? A chimney inspection typically involves examining the chimney structure, checking for creosote buildup, inspecting the flue liner, and assessing the overall condition of the chimney system.

How often should a chimney be inspected? It is recommended to have a chimney inspected at least once a year, especially if it is used regularly or shows signs of damage.

What are the signs that a chimney needs inspection or repair? Signs include smoke backing into the home, a strong odor, visible creosote buildup, cracks or damage in the chimney structure, or unusual noises during operation.

What types of chimney inspections are available? There are typically three levels of inspection: Level 1 (basic visual), Level 2 (more detailed, often with video scanning), and Level 3 (comprehensive, including structural assessment if needed).
